Initial Public Offerings (IPOs)
An Initial Public Offering (IPO) marks the moment a private company first sells its shares to public investors. This significant event enables companies to gather capital from the market, which can be allocated for various purposes such as growth initiatives, debt reduction, or funding research and development. For investors, IPOs offer a rare chance to buy into a company from the ground up, with the potential for strong financial returns as the company scales.
Growth Opportunities: IPOs typically involve companies that are ready for substantial growth. Investing early can position you to reap benefits from their expansion and increasing market presence.
Enhanced Diversification: Incorporating IPOs into your portfolio can boost diversification. Newly created public firms often emerge in dynamic sectors or innovative industries, exposing you to varied market forces.
Market Indicator: IPOs can indicate overall market sentiment. A successful offer often signifies strong investor confidence in the economy and specific sectors, which can positively influence your investment strategy.
